Others have provided good advice here. I have D type in my 1800 and performed only simple maintenance on it when I had it on the bench recently. In addition to the O ring replacement mentioned, it can't hurt to replace the gasket behind the strainer plate. They are still available, as is the strainer. In my case, I also replaced the wire from the solenoid to the switch when it was easy to use solder and shrink wrap. My mechanic instructed me to use only 30 wt. oil in trannys with OD.
Are you comfortable with the corrosion on the thermostat housing? New housings are less than 50.00 USD and, in my view, cheap insurance.
